Unidentified Tusken Raider youngling


A male child of the Tusken Raider species was a member of a tribe dwelling in Tatooine's Dune Sea. Boba Fett, the bounty hunter who had fallen, was held as a prisoner by this tribe, and the youngling kept watch over him, even striking him upon their initial encounter. Fett's attempted escape from the tribe's camp was thwarted by the young Tusken's efforts, although the older Tuskens ultimately recaptured him.

Later, the Tusken youngling, accompanied by his massiff pet, escorted Fett and a Rodian prisoner into the desert. They witnessed the Kintan Striders Gang assaulting a moisture farm. Subsequently, the child commanded his two captives to unearth black melons. However, a sand beast emerged, killing the Rodian. During the ensuing conflict, the youngling fled, only for Fett to slay the beast. This act earned Fett acceptance into the tribe, leading him to impart combat skills to the Tuskens for their defense against the intruding Pyke Syndicate.

Some time later, after Fett's vision quest, the youngling alerted the tribe to his return and observed his interaction with the Tusken chieftain and a Tusken warrior. The child then guided Fett to a nearby Tusken workshop, where the former bounty hunter fashioned his own gaderffii stick. After Fett's visit to the boss of the Pyke Syndicate's Tatooine operations, the syndicate launched a massacre against the Tusken tribe. Discovering the tribe's destruction, Fett cremated their remains and burned the child's small gaderffii stick.

Biography

Child of the sand

The Tusken Raider male youngling was a member of a Tusken Raider tribe that made their home in the Dune Sea of the desert planet Tatooine. Around 4 ABY, following the defeat of the renowned bounty hunter Boba Fett at the Great Pit of Carkoon and his subsequent capture by Tuskens, the child, along with other Tusken children, examined the restrained Fett and proceeded to strike the prisoner with sticks. That night, the bound Fett was left near a fireplace, watched over by the youngling's massiff and with the youngling standing guard. When Fett managed to break free, a Rodian prisoner who was tied up next to him alerted the tribe. The child then charged at the escaped captive, wielding his stick and yelling. Fett knocked the Tusken child down and took his stick, choosing not to strike the startled Tusken before fleeing the camp as other Tuskens arrived, alerted by the youngling's cries. The Tusken Raiders quickly managed to recapture Fett.

The following morning, the child woke Fett and the Rodian, untying them. He guided the prisoners and the massiff across Tatooine's dunes, pulling Fett as he struggled to walk due to his weakened state. The group arrived at a moisture farm that was being raided by the Kintan Striders Gang, a group of Nikto speed bikers. As a result, the child changed course and led them to a different location to dig for black melons.

Once they arrived, the Tusken youngling instructed Fett and the Rodian to dig for the melons. While the Rodian obeyed immediately, Fett struggled to understand the Tusken's instructions. After figuring out what the child wanted, Fett began digging under the watchful eyes of the Tusken and the massiff. When Fett tried to drink from a melon, the young Tusken angrily struck at him with his stick. Fett caught the stick and insisted he needed to drink. The youngling took the black melon from his prisoner and proceeded to pour its milk out for his massiff. Later, as the child slept beside the massiff, he was awakened by a sand beast that the Rodian prisoner had unearthed. The Tusken watched in shock as the sand beast targeted the Rodian before launching the massiff over the youngling's head after the smaller creature attacked it.

While the sand beast killed the Rodian and held Fett up, the Tusken child attempted to fight the creature by stabbing it in the foot with his small gaderffii stick. However, the creature struck him and threw him back. The sand beast then focused on the youngling, who frantically fled as the creature chased him. Fett pursued the beast and used his chains to strangle it to death. Seeing the creature dead, the youngling shouted with excitement. The Tusken child, Fett, and the massiff returned to the camp, with the youngling carrying the severed head of the creature as a trophy and shouting excitedly. He presented the trophy to the older Tuskens, who gathered around him as the child acted out the fight. The adult Tuskens congratulated the child with cheers and celebratory pats.

Train spotting

Fett gained acceptance from the tribe and began living among them. Around 5 ABY, the Tuskens came into conflict with a repulsor train operated by the Pyke Syndicate, which fired on the tribe as it passed through the Dune Sea. Fett devised a plan to stop the train, which involved teaching the tribe members various skills, such as riding speeder bikes. He also taught the child to use a mirror to reflect sunlight from Tatooine's two suns as a signal to the rest of the tribe when the train approached.

Later, the tribe went to dig for more black melons in the dunes when the Pyke repulsor train returned. Alerted to the train's arrival, the child began running towards his designated position atop a large dune. As he ran, he used his mirror to signal other Tuskens positioned further along the train's route to surprise the Pykes. Fett and a group of Tuskens were able to stop the repulsor train and send its Pyke personnel back to their superiors with a warning.

Fett's integration

The Tusken chieftain later sent Fett on a vision quest, which led him to a wortwood tree. The following day, the youngling was sitting with his massiff, cracking nuts into a bucket, when the massiff alerted him to someone approaching. The youngling realized it was Fett, carrying a large branch from the wortwood tree. He alerted the rest of the tribe to Fett's return before rushing to Fett and jumping excitedly. The youngling watched Fett's exchange with the tribe's chieftain and a Tusken warrior before being led into one of the tribe's tents. When Fett emerged, the chieftain gestured for the youngling to lead the man across the dunes to a workshop at a wreck site, where a Tusken craftsman helped Fett craft a gaderffii stick from the wortwood branch.

Some time later, Fett left the camp on a bantha to negotiate protection fees with the boss of the Pyke Syndicate on Tatooine. The Tusken youngling watched Fett leave for the Pyke's headquarters at the Mos Eisley spaceport, with Fett nodding at the child as he departed. However, while Fett was away, the Pyke boss sent his forces to destroy the Tusken tribe. The Pykes massacred the Tuskens, including the youngling, and left the Kintan Striders' emblem to frame them. Upon Fett's return, he cremated and mourned the fallen Tuskens, burning the youngling's small gaderffii stick in a fire. Fett later sought revenge on the Kintan Striders in 9 ABY, believing they were responsible for the massacre, but he eventually learned that the Pykes were the true culprits. Fett ultimately fought and defeated the syndicate in the battle, forcing them to abandon Tatooine.

Personality and traits

The youngling exhibited sadistic tendencies, such as striking Fett when he was a helpless prisoner and pouring the contents of a black melon onto the ground for his massiff instead of allowing Fett to drink. When Fett drank water from a black melon, the youngling became aggressive and tried to strike the human with his stick.

When the sand beast attacked the child and his prisoners, the child was initially shocked and froze but then attacked the beast when it lashed out at the youngling's massiff. After Fett defeated the Tatooine sand beast, the child returned with its head, triumphantly recounting the story to the other Tuskens. Following Fett's acceptance by the tribe, the child became excited whenever he returned to the camp, even jumping with excitement upon Fett's return from his vision quest. The Tusken youngling communicated in Tusken.

Equipment

The youngling wore dark brown robes covering his torso, a tan headwrap concealing his face, tan gloves, dark brown pants, and a tube-like accessory around his neck. He also had a red pouch and a dirty white towel on his chest. The youngling used a small gaderffii stick, similar to the larger ones used by adult Tuskens. During the attack on the Pyke Syndicate's repulsortrain, he used a small mirror to signal other Tuskens by reflecting sunlight.

Behind the scenes

The Tusken Raider child made his debut in the flashbacks of "Chapter 1: Stranger in a Strange Land," the first episode of the Disney+ series The Book of Boba Fett, which premiered on December 29, 2021. Wesley Kimmel played the child. The 2023 junior novelization of The Book of Boba Fett by Joe Schreiber adapted lines from the show, sometimes presenting them differently. This article uses the versions from the show in those cases.
